Battered Sausages Recipe

Battered sausages are an essential staple at fish and chip shops across the UK. Try our version and you'll be hooked.

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es
Servings: 8

Equipment

  • deep fryer or dutch oven
  • food thermometer
  • baking or cooling rack
  • paper towel

Ingredients

Battered Sausage

  • 1 Pound Kielbasa (or other sausage)
  • 3/4 Cup All-purpose flour Extra for coating
  • 1/4 Cup Cornstarch or Rice Flour
  • 1 1/4 Tsp Baking Powder
  • 1 Cup Beer Very Cold
  • 1/4 Tsp Salt

Horseradish Honey Mustard

  • 1/4 cup Honey Mustard
  • 1 1/2 tsp Horseradish

Chipotle Mayo

  • 1/4 cup Mayo
  • 1 tbsp Canned Chipotle Sauce

Instructions

  • Mix each sauce in small bowls and refrigerate until ready to eat.
  • Preheat the oil to 350 degrees.
  • Add the ¾ cup flour, corn starch, baking powder, beer, salt in a large bowl. Mix until thoroughly combined and smooth. Do not make the batter until the oil is heated up.
  • Coat the sausage with flour, then dip into the batter.
  • Cook in batches. Fry for 3-5 minutes or until golden brown. Continue until all batches are done. Enjoy!

Notes

  • We cut our sausages to about 3 inches long which is more than one serving.
  • You can also cut the sausage into medallions to make an appetizer.
  • Your frying station setup should flow like this: sausages => flour => batter => deep fryer/dutch oven => baking rack
  • This recipe is excellent to reheat in an air fryer at 400 degrees for 3 -5 minutes.
  • Oil should be at least 2 to 3 inches deep to submerge fully.
  • To avoid lowering the temperature too much, fry in small batches.
  • Bring the temperature back up to 350-degrees between each batch.
